What's MACRS Depreciation ?
MACRS would be the IRS-approved technique of depreciating property intended for tax purposes. This will allow real estate property traders for you to take the particular depreciation of the property from them taxed revenue, distributed for a collection period. For residential rental components, the particular depreciation interval is usually 27.5 years, whilst business oriented attributes are generally depreciated in excess of 39 years. This means that traders can easily subtract some sort of part of the property's cost yearly for up to several decades, decreasing their total tax burden.

2. Allows Offset Rental Profits
Rental salary is normally taxed, however with MACRS depreciation , buyers can countered the majority of that will income. As an example, should your rental property generates $15,000 in cash flow yearly but the truth is can easily depreciate $10,000 in the property's benefit, your current taxable salary comes significantly. The following minimizes the total amount that you owe with income taxes, even if the property remains making beneficial income flow.
3. Tax Deferral Positive aspects
Although depreciation minimizes after tax cash flow, that the trader will pay not any fees at all. Rather, depreciation defers income taxes to your later on date. This specific is beneficial because you're free to preserve even more of your revenue today, as an alternative to paying out taxes upfront. After you ultimately advertise the actual property , you may encounter your recapture tax on the depreciation , today some buyers however find the deferral well worth the trade-off.
